We did a little over 400 at the wheels a couple years ago with the stock airbox, charge tubes, and intercooler. That was also when we had less ECM access and stock fuel pressure. 400 should be pretty easy with this turbo and minimal mods.
Valvesprings are not required to hit 400. This turbo spools soon enough to keep the shift points lower if you need to. Of course swapping the valvesprings allow you to turn up the boost and/or rev it out further.
